A pair of Wedgwood 'variegated agate' vases and covers, circa 1780 of egg form, the surface simulating agate in tones of brown and cream slip, applied with two gilded loop handles with satyr mask terminals, the body with a moulded band from which hangs an applied band of fabric festoons, the shoulder and foot with stiff acanthus leaf bands and foot with leaf moulded edge, all picked out in gilding, supported on white stoneware bases with moulded guilloche panels, bases with impressed WEDGWOOD marks, Quantity: 4 23.5cm., 9 1/4 in. high
